nvALT: nvALT is a simple and lightweight note taking app for macOS. It supports easy organization of text notes, fast searching, tagging, and syncing notes across devices.

Reactgo: Reactgo is an open-source web app framework for building user interfaces and single-page applications using React. It provides routing, state management, and a component library out of the box.
